            • Originally posted by pritish View Post
              The local mech opened up the panel..and he said..there was some loose fittings near magnet..because of which gradually it got loosened up..and some parts got tangled with the coils inside...eventually turns out to be a total mesh with some broken parts...damn these TVS guys have to ramp up their quality..how can they do some fitting like this and not check it...while assembling the bike....newazzz i have to load it on a tempo traveller and take it to svc..and see by myslef how bad it is...

              The broken parts are from the One-way clutch... Thats why its not advisable to ride around in that condition... Cos the loose bits tangle with the magneto coil as you ride and may damage it... When I got this problem, even with the grinding noise I kept on tryin to start it and finally ended up with a bent valve... I finally took the vehicle to SVC in a small tempo type vehicle.. Just get it to the damn Svc as soon as possible and think abt stuff later...
